The Importance Of Procurement & Sourcing In Modern Business Operations

In today’s competitive business landscape, companies are constantly looking for ways to improve their operational efficiency and reduce costs One area that is often overlooked but plays a critical role in achieving these goals is procurement and sourcing This is the process of acquiring goods, services, or works from an external source, and it encompasses everything from negotiating contracts with suppliers to managing supplier relationships.

Effective procurement and sourcing practices can have a significant impact on a company’s bottom line By sourcing materials and services at the best possible price and quality, companies can reduce their costs and improve profitability In addition, strategic sourcing can help companies mitigate risks, improve supply chain performance, and drive innovation.

One of the key benefits of effective procurement and sourcing is cost savings By negotiating favorable terms with suppliers and leveraging buying power, companies can secure lower prices for their goods and services This can result in significant cost savings, which can be reinvested back into the business or passed on to customers in the form of lower prices In a highly competitive market, cost savings can be a key differentiator for companies looking to gain a competitive edge.

Procurement and sourcing also play a critical role in risk management By diversifying their supplier base and conducting thorough due diligence on potential suppliers, companies can reduce the risk of supply chain disruptions This is especially important in today’s globalized economy, where companies rely on a network of suppliers from around the world By proactively managing risks, companies can ensure continuity of supply and minimize the impact of unforeseen events.

In addition to cost savings and risk management, effective procurement and sourcing practices can also drive innovation By collaborating closely with suppliers and sharing information and ideas, companies can tap into the expertise and capabilities of their supply chain partners This can lead to the development of new products, services, or processes that differentiate the company from its competitors and create value for customers.

Companies must develop a clear procurement strategy that aligns with their business objectives and drives value for the organization This involves identifying key sourcing categories, conducting thorough market analysis, and selecting the right suppliers based on criteria such as cost, quality, and reliability.

Furthermore, companies must invest in technology and tools that enable effective procurement and sourcing processes This can include e-procurement systems, supplier relationship management software, and analytics tools that provide real-time visibility into the supply chain By leveraging technology, companies can streamline their procurement processes, improve efficiency, and make more informed decisions.

Another important aspect of procurement and sourcing is supplier relationship management Building strong relationships with suppliers is crucial for long-term success, as it can lead to better pricing, improved quality, and greater collaboration Companies must communicate openly and transparently with their suppliers, provide feedback on performance, and work together to address challenges and drive continuous improvement.

Furthermore, companies must also consider sustainability and ethical sourcing practices when selecting suppliers In today’s socially conscious world, consumers are increasingly concerned about the environmental and social impact of the products they buy By working with suppliers that adhere to sustainable and ethical practices, companies can enhance their brand reputation and attract socially responsible customers.
